Features and benefits

Features and benefits

In a nutshell, the Fox DataDiode offers the following features and benefits:

  • Unique hardware-based, one-way data link.
  • Error detection and correction for data integrity.
  • Time synchonisation for the high-security network.
  • Event logging and SNMP traps on both sides of the data transfer.
  • Easy to use web interface for users, administrators and auditors.
  • Approved by the NL-NCSA, BSI, Common Criteria EAL 7+, and up to and incl. NATO SECRET.
  • No need for time-consuming, risky and expensive manual transportation of data e.g. USB-stick.

To place things in perspective, it is useful to review the current alternative: the manual air-gap data transfer procedure. In addition to the effort, time and cost involved, this form of data transfer also introduces security risks through possible loss of portable storage media, or their incorrect disposal. Moreover, this type of transfer is neither continuous, nor is it conducted online nor in real-time.

Fox DataDiode solution

The Fox DataDiode basic solution consists of three elements:

  • Hardware Data Diode
  • Data Diode proxy Servers
  • Data Diode Software

The basic solution can be augmented with additional application servers to add specific functionality to one-way transfer.
